怎样将EXCEL数据表导入到SQL中

嘿,朋友们!今天要教大家如何用Office2 007 版本的软件进行数据导入,超级简单,跟我一起操作吧!
1 . 首先,咱们在MySQL管理工具里创建一个新的表格。
2 . 接下来,打开Excel表格,按照数据库的字段填写数据哦。
3 . 然后,打开Navicat for MySQL,选中相应的数据库,点击数据库名字,右键选择“导入向导”,如果有汉化版本的话,操作会更直观呢。
4 . 弹出选择界面后,选择Excel文件,点击下一步,选择你要导入的Excel文件,然后找到Sheet3 ,因为我们的数据都在那里。
5 . 再点击下一步,注意看两个地方:一个是“字段名行”,就是Excel中字段的位置,比如第几行;另一个是“第一数据行”,这里一般选3 或4 行开始导入。
6 . 点击下一步,选择目标表,确定导入的数据库和表,一直点击下一步直到完成。

完成之后,你就可以在数据库中看到和Excel表格一样的数据啦!操作简单不?快来试试吧!

如何Extjs将Excel导入到数据库

啊,最近在琢磨Extjs怎么把Excel里的数据弄到数据库里,这里给大家分享下我的小经验。
其实方法还挺简单的,主要分两步走:
第一步,得用DataDrop这个功能。
简单说就是,你把Excel表格里的数据拖拽到Extjs的GridPanel里,它就能自动帮你把数据读进来了。
这个功能用起来特别方便,省去了手动输入的麻烦。

第二步,就是利用Extjs操作数据库的接口,把GridPanel里的数据批量插入到数据库中。
这一步需要写点代码,调用相应的API接口,把数据传过去就行了。

总的来说,用Extjs导入Excel数据到数据库,主要就是这两个步骤。
当然,具体实现的时候可能还会遇到些小问题,比如数据格式不兼容之类的,但只要细心调试一下,都能解决。
希望这个分享对大家有帮助!

如何将Excel数据追加到数据库中已存在的表

哈喽大家好,今天想跟大家聊聊怎么把Excel里的数据弄到数据库里已经存在的表格里。
这事儿啊,关键要看Excel的表头和数据库表字段的对应关系,得根据情况来采取措施。
下面是一些常见的场景和对应的解决方法,咱们一起来瞅瞅:
场景一:Excel表头和数据库表字段完全一样
这最简单直接啦!步骤也简单:
1 . 选文件:打开你的导入工具(比如“的卢导表”就行),然后点选你要导入的Excel文件。
2 . 定目标表:在工具里手动指定一下,数据要导入到数据库里的哪个表。
3 . 字段对齐:这里关键一步,选择“按名称匹配字段”。
因为表头和字段名都一样,这个选项最合适。
4 . 开始导入:一切设置好了,点那个“开始”按钮,数据就自动跑进数据库啦!
举个例子,假设Excel表头是ID,Name,Age,数据库表字段也是ID,Name,Age,那就直接按上述步骤操作就行。
至于具体的图片展示,这里就省略啦。

场景二:Excel表头和数据库表字段名不一样,但顺序是一致的
这种情况也挺常见的,虽然字段名不同,但顺序对得上。
操作步骤稍微有点不一样:
1 . 选文件和定目标表:跟场景一一样,先选文件,再指定目标表。
2 . 字段对齐:这次不能按名称匹配了,得选“按顺序匹配字段”。
因为顺序一致,工具会根据顺序自动对应。
3 . 开始导入:设置完成后,点“开始”,搞定!
比如,Excel表头是姓名,年龄,编号,数据库表字段是ID,Name,Age。
虽然名字不一样,但顺序都对得上,那就用这个方法。

场景三:Excel表头和数据库表字段名都不一样,而且顺序还乱七八糟
这个就稍微复杂一点,需要手动指定映射关系:
1 . 选文件和定目标表:跟前面一样,先选文件,再指定目标表。
2 . 字段对齐:选择“自定义匹配字段”。
这个选项能让你手动指定Excel的表头和数据库表字段之间的对应关系。
3 . 填映射文件:需要额外准备一个字段映射文件,把Excel的表头和数据库表字段对应起来。
比如: Excel表头|数据库表字段 客户编号|ID 客户姓名|CustomerName 客户年龄|Age 4 . 开始导入:设置完成后,点“开始”,导入数据。

这个方法比较灵活,适用于各种复杂的场景。

场景四:Excel表头数量比数据库表字段多,或者少
这种情况得看情况处理,主要有两种策略:
策略一:忽略多余的Excel字段
1 . 选文件和定目标表:跟前面一样,先选文件,再指定目标表。
2 . 字段对齐:选择“按名称匹配字段”,但在设置里选择忽略多余的Excel字段。
3 . 开始导入:设置完成后,点“开始”,导入数据。

这个策略适用于那些多余的Excel字段在数据库里根本用不上,可以安全忽略的情况。

策略二:在数据库表中新增多余的列
1 . 修改数据库表结构:先去数据库里,把目标表修改一下,新增那些Excel里有多余字段对应的列。
2 . 选文件和定目标表:再回到导入工具,选文件,指定目标表。
3 . 字段对齐:选择“按名称匹配字段”,这次要把新增的列也映射上。
4 . 开始导入:设置完成后,点“开始”,导入数据。

这个策略适用于那些多余的Excel字段在数据库里是有用的,需要保存的情况。

举个例子,Excel表头是ID,Name,Age,Fee(手续费),数据库表字段是ID,Name,Age。
如果Fee字段在数据库里不需要,就用策略一;如果需要,就用策略二。

场景五:Excel没有表头
这种情况比较特殊,因为Excel数据直接就是一排排的,没有表头说明啥。
操作步骤也稍微有点不一样:
1 . 选文件:打开导入工具,选你要导入的Excel文件。
2 . 设置表头所在行:在工具里设置一下,表头所在行为0。
因为根本没有表头,所以设置为0。
3 . 定目标表:手动指定目标表。
4 . 字段对齐:选择“按顺序匹配字段”。
因为没表头,工具会根据数据顺序自动对应。
5 . 开始导入:设置完成后,点“开始”,导入数据。

比如,Excel数据(无表头)是1 ,张三,2 5 、2 ,李四,3 0,数据库表字段是ID,Name,Age。
这种情况下,就得用这个方法。

好啦,以上就是将Excel数据追加到数据库中已存在的表的一些常见场景和解决方法。
希望对大家有帮助!如果还有其他问题,欢迎留言讨论哦!

如何把excel表内容导入到Oracle数据库中

嘿,小伙伴们!想要把Excel里的数据轻松导入Oracle数据库?没问题!咱们就用PL/SQLDeveloper的ODBC导入器来搞定。
跟着我一步步来,保证你轻松上手!
首先,打开PL/SQLDeveloper,进入那个熟悉的界面。
然后,找到菜单栏里的“工具”选项,点击它,再选择“ODBC导入器”。

接下来,咱们要配置数据源和目标源。
在操作界面里,有两个地方要注意:
1 . “来自ODBC的数据”这里,咱们选择“ExcelFiles”作为数据源。
2 . “到ORACLE的数据”这一栏,记得填写你想导入的目标Oracle数据库的表名。

然后,找到并选中你要导入的Excel文件。
在文件列表里,勾选你想要导入的Excel表。
对了,这时候你会在右侧的“结果预览”区域看到表里的数据。

现在,咱们得建立字段映射关系。
这个步骤很重要,得把Excel的列名和Oracle表的字段名一一对应起来。
搞错了这个,导入就失败了哦!
一切设置妥当后,点击左下角的“导入”按钮,系统就会自动帮你传输数据啦。

导入完成后,别忘了验证一下结果。
用SQL查询语句(比如SELECT FROM 表名)看看数据是否成功导入,还得确认有没有重复记录。

最后,提醒一下注意事项:

字段映射要准确,Excel的列名和Oracle表的字段类型、顺序必须一致。

Excel表要选对,不然字段预览区域不会显示数据,影响操作。

数据格式要兼容,Excel里的日期、数值等格式得和Oracle表字段定义匹配,别让格式冲突导致数据乱套了。

好啦,操作步骤就到这里啦!祝你顺利导入数据,加油哦!